§ 4-118. Condition of pen and premises.  


Latest version.
  • It shall be unlawful for any person keeping or harboring dogs to fail to keep the premises where such dogs are kept free from offensive odors to the extent that such odors are disturbing to any person residing within reasonable proximity of the said premises; further, it shall be unlawful to allow such premises where dogs are kept to become unclean and a threat to public health by failing to diligently and systematically remove all animal waste from the premises.

(Code 1976, § 4-37)
